It may seem obvious, but the most important and debilitating indication that you may require hip replacement surgery is pain: pain around the hip, groin or even radiating down to the knee. No two hip pains are the same. Your hip pain may be made worse by exercise or by being at rest. It may be worse in the morning or in the evening.

WebMost initial hip or knee replacement parts are designed to last 15 to 20 years. If you get a replacement surgery at a younger age, you may be more likely to need a revision surgery later as the components naturally wear out over time.
